EKITI NURTW SWEARS-IN NEW BRANCH EXECUTIVES

…as State Chairman, Chief Falope Charges them on development

The newly elected executive members of the National Union of Road Transport Workers in all the branches in Ado Ekiti have been sworn in.

Performing the swearing ceremony at the State Secretariat at the Union Secretariat, Ekiti State NURTW Chairman, Chief Joseph Falope charged the new executive to carry all members along and ensure development in their various branches.

Chief Falope known as Oloforo aslo urged them to always maintain peace in their branches and obey all the rules of the union.

He therefore appealed to the executives to support present administration led by Governor Biodun Oyebanji to succeed.

In their remarks, some of the newly sworn in chairmen, Mr Ajayi Abiodun, Oluwatoba Ogungbemi appreciated the leadership of NURTW for the confidence reposed in them and promised to bring unprecedented development to their branches.
